问题描述
有没有办法在 WPF WebBrowser 控件上禁用捏合和缩放.环境是一个使用 .NET4.0 的 win8 桌面 WPF 应用程序.使用 regedit 设置告诉它使用 IE10 引擎.
Is there a way to disable pinch and zoom on a WPF WebBrowser Control. The enviroment is a win8 Desktop WPF app using .NET4.0. With a regedit setting that tells it to use IE10 engine.
我已经尝试使用 css 来禁用它,但不适用于 WebBrowser Control.如果从网络浏览器查看页面,它确实有效.
I have already tried using css to disable it but does not work for WebBrowser Control. It does work if the page is viewed from web browsers.
推荐答案
如果仍有兴趣,您需要禁用 禁用 WebBrowser 控件的 IE 旧版输入模型.我刚刚在这里和这里,有一个有效的示例项目.
If still interested, you'd need to disable Disable IE Legacy Input Model for WebBrowser control. I've just answered similar questions here and here, with a working sample project.
这篇关于WPF WebBrowser Control 在 win8 桌面上禁用捏合和缩放的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!